Guia d'usuari de la biblioteca de programari STUSB1602 per a STM32F446
Biblioteca de programari STUSB1602 per a STM32F446

Introducció

Aquest document ofereix un sobreview del paquet de programari STUSB1602 que permet la pila USB PD amb l'escut NUCLEO-F446ZE i MB1303

PROGRAMARI

STSW-STUSB012

Biblioteca de programari STUSB1602 per a STM32F446

IAR 8.x

Compilador de codi C

MATERIAL

NUCLEO-F446ZE

Placa de desenvolupament STM32 Nucleo-144

P-NUCLEO-USB002

STUSB1602 Nucleo Pack que conté MB1303 blindatge (la placa d'expansió Nucleo s'ha de connectar a NUCLEO-F446ZE)

Configuració de la biblioteca SW

  1. Baixeu el paquet de programari STUSB1602 cercant STSW-STUSB012 a www.st.com pàgina d'inici:
    Biblioteca SW
  2. A continuació, feu clic a "Obtenir programari" a la part inferior o superior de la pàgina
    Biblioteca SW
  3. La descàrrega començarà després d'acceptar l'Acord de llicència i d'omplir la informació de contacte.
    Biblioteca SW
  4. Guarda el file en.STSW-STUSB012.zip al vostre ordinador portàtil
    Biblioteca SW
    i descomprimiu:
    Biblioteca SW
  5. El paquet conté un directori DOC, un binari llest per utilitzar files, projectes associats i informes de compliment

Requisits de maquinari suggerits

La biblioteca de programari s'ha optimitzat per compilar ràpidament a la placa de desenvolupament NUCLEO-F446FE apilada amb la placa d'expansió MB1303 (del paquet P-NUCLEO-USB002).
L'MB1303 es compon de 2 ports de doble funció (DRP) USB PD (factor de forma no optimitzat)

  • NUCLEO-F446ZE
    NUCLEO-F446ZE
  • MB1303
    MB1303

NUCLEO-F446ZE Configuració del maquinari

Configuració de maquinari

S'ha acabat el paquet de programariview

La biblioteca de programari inclou 8 marcs de programari diferents (+ 3 sense RTOS) ja optimitzats per abordar l'escenari d'aplicació més habitual:

Projecte

Típic Aplicació

#1

STM32F446_MB1303_SRC_ONLY(*) Proveïdor/FONT (gestió d'energia)

#2

STM32F446_MB1303_SRC_VDM Proveïdor/FONT (gestió d'energia)
+ suport de missatges estès

#3

STM32F446_MB1303_SNK_ONLY(*) Consumidor / AIMERA (gestió d'energia)

#4

STM32F446_MB1303_SNK_VDM Consumidor / AIMERA (gestió d'energia)
+ suport de missatges estès + suport UFP

#5

STM32F446_MB1303_DRP_ONLY (*) Port de doble funció (gestió d'energia) + mode de bateria morta

#6

STM32F446_MB1303_DRP_VDM Port de doble funció (gestió d'energia) + mode de bateria morta
+ suport de missatges estès + suport UFP

#7

STM32F446_MB1303_DRP_2ports 2 x Port de doble funció (gestió d'energia) + mode de bateria morta
+ suport de missatges estès + suport UFP

#8

STM32F446_MB1303_DRP_SRCING_DEVICE Port de doble funció que sol·licita PR_swap quan està connectat a Sink o DR_swap quan està connectat a Source
  • per defecte, tots els projectes estan empaquetats amb suport RTOS
  • Els projectes anotats amb (*) estan disponibles amb i sense suport RTOS

Per obtenir més detalls, consulteu la documentació del paquet de firmware:

Paquet de firmware

 

Documents/Recursos

Biblioteca de programari ST STUSB1602 per a STM32F446 [pdfGuia de l'usuari
STUSB1602, Biblioteca de programari per a STM32F446

Referències

Deixa un comentari

La teva adreça de correu electrònic no es publicarà. Els camps obligatoris estan marcats *